Main Elements of the Compliance Readiness Program Work Breakdown Structure Template
This template is structured to cover all critical phases of compliance readiness:
- Regulatory Assessment:
Identify applicable laws and regulations, assess current compliance status, and document gaps.
- Policy and Procedure Development:
Create or update policies, standard operating procedures, and internal controls to meet requirements.
- Training and Awareness:
Plan and execute training programs for employees and management to ensure understanding of compliance obligations.
- Implementation and Monitoring:
Deploy compliance measures, conduct internal audits, and monitor adherence continuously.
- Audit Preparation and Response:
Prepare documentation and evidence for external audits, manage findings, and implement corrective actions.
Each task within these elements can be assigned a unique WBS number, key stakeholders, project phase, and progress status, enabling comprehensive oversight and management.
